Who is Antoni Gaudi?

Antoni Gaudi lived from 1852 until 1926 and he’s considered to be the best Spanish modernist architect. He lived and worked most of his life in Barcelona. In his design work, he tried to combine elements from nature, religion and architecture.

Gaudi’s life work was the construction of the Sagrada Familia. The church was commissioned in 1883 and it’s still not finished today! Gaudi knew he would never see it completed so he left detailed instructions on how it should be completed.

FAQ about Gaudi Tours in Barcelona

Is Gaudi free?

The architect Antoni Gaudi designed a few buildings and a park in Barcelona. You can walk past the houses and admire the facade for free but you have to pay for every building to see the inside.

Is Parc Guell free entry?

Unfortunately, Park Güell is not free to visit, but with a €10 admission fee, it’s the cheapest Gaudi attraction to see from the inside.

Is Sagrada Familia free?

While marvelling at the Sagrada Familia from the outside (on the other side of a fence) is free, entering the church is not free. As a matter of fact, it’s the most expensive church I’ve ever visited. As of March 2023, the entrance fee for one adult is €38.
